Output 580c5f8f933ae8d53334869d68d70af7a8e4d55530df87ab36f234fe6a857c0f:0

value
553264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c739b20a8ce00d1ef9f8ddaa5a227d70a60ecf1a OP_EQUAL
address
3KrRWUCbzW2ThPVbnDHXVTWZQAn57nMdkK
transaction
580c5f8f933ae8d53334869d68d70af7a8e4d55530df87ab36f234fe6a857c0f
spent
true